Ilo Zelmar Hall
18 July 1907 ---- 20 February 1937

The funeral of Ilo Zelmar Hall of Dixon, Ill., was held at the Kubitschek & Kastler funeral home on Tuesday afternoon at 2:00 o’clock, the Rev. Albert S. Kilbourn officiating. Appropriate duets were sung by Frank Wells and Mrs. Vina Hall. Burial was at Rose Hill cemetery.

Obituary

Ilo Zelmar Hall, son of the late Edward and Laura Mundt Hall, was born in Eagle Grove, Iowa, Jan. 18, 1907, and passed away at Dixon, Ill, Saturday Feb. 20, 1937, his age being at the time of his death, 29 years, 7 months, and 2 days.

He received his education in the schools of Eagle Grove and Dixon as he and his mother removed to Dixon in 1921, the father having lost his life on the C. & N. W. R. R. at Tama, Iowa, the preceding year, as he was performing his duty as a freight conductor.

He had been in ill health for 20 years. Since the death of his mother December 1935, his health has steadily declined.

He leaves to mourn their loss four sisters, Mrs. Goldie Peterson and Mrs. Hazel Wetter of Peoria, Ill., Mrs. Priscilla Smith, with whom he had made his home at Dixon, Ill., and Mrs. Georgia Middleton of Webster City, and three nephews, Earl Peterson and Lowell Smith of Peoria and Jack Wetter of Dixon, Ill. He was a nephew of Charles Hall and a cousin of Frank and Earl Hall of Eagle Grove.

EAGLE GROVE EAGLE --- Eagle Grove, Iowa
Thursday, February 25, 1937
